Attending Kaplan University's online campus is a great way to meet new people. There is no such thing as the "typical student" at Kaplan. There are students from all over the nation. I was afraid that taking 3 years off after high school would make me the oldest in my class who procrastinated and didn't do the "right thing", which is attending college right out of high school. I was proven wrong. There were students younger than me, yes, but there were also students all the way up into their 60's. I was shown that you're not a "loser" just because your life lead you somewhere else after high school. All that is important is that you have chosen to further yourself in your career and in your life by attending college. The students are supportive, friendly, and helpful. As Secretary of the KU Ambassadors and Leaders Group I have learned just how great the students at Kaplan are. People are always helping each other; in the classrooms, seminars, with homework, etc. I've also made many friends that I hope will be life-long. It is just a wonderful thing to know that you are surrounded by people going through the exact same challenges as you and who are ready to help when they can.

Students mostly interact in professional manners. It is rare that a student attacks or discriminates against other students as there is zero-tolerance for this type of action. Discussion boards are open to all opinions and if topics go into that semi-red area where students may be offended, the professors remind everyone that there is no wrong or right answer to a question on opinion, and to respect each other's ideas. For me, I enjoy learning how other's feel about different situations and consider how their ideas are accurate.

The majority of students at Kaplan are female. They are primarily made up of stay at home mothers. I often am in classes where I'm the only male there, which can be very strange and make one feel like they're walking on egg shells. There are also a good bit of "bible thumpers" going to this school. You will occasionally run into the God fanatic that will make your learning experience miserable. There are also some students from out of country. There is also a lack of spelling ability with a good part of the students I've had the pleasure of being with in classes (as well as bad grammar). Everyone isn't perfect, but they do make spell checkers and grammar checkers for this. You do have the potential of meeting new "friends" with Kaplan, but since this isn't a traditional campus, your only outlets are social sites or if they trust you enough over the phone conversations.
